Emeritus employees who return to the campus after retirement to work for compensation are required to pay to park during that time. Some Emeritus/Retired employees are eligible to receive a courtesy Emeritus parking permit provided that they meet the requirements outlined in the University’s Emeritus Status policy. If your vehicle is registered in the State of California, the State requires that two plates be displayed, one in the front and one in the back of the vehicle (California Vehicle Code 5200). A parking permit does not guarantee a parking space in any given area at any given time. We assume no responsibility whatsoever for loss or damage due to fire, theft, collision or otherwise to the vehicle or its contents however caused. Charges are for the use of parking space only. It is important to familiarize yourself with the various types of parking permits Sacramento State offers and the locations in which they are valid. However, employees and students may also purchase an additional adhesive motorcycle permit if desired. Each person may possess one valid Sacramento State parking permit at a time. The permit holder is responsible for all citations issued to vehicles linked to their permit. Only one vehicle may use a parking permit each day. A parking permit is valid for use only by the person who purchased the parking permit. Parking permits may not be altered in any way. Parking permits are valid only for the period of time specified on the permit and for the parking spaces intended unless otherwise posted. Pursuant to Title 5, Article 7, Section 42201(a) of the California Code of Regulations, the University president may grant permission to park on campus, "to those persons who have paid a parking fee." This includes students, staff, faculty, and University visitors.
As a self-supported operation, 100% of the budget comes from permit sales.
